Deck Spindle Repair in Seattle, WA
Deck spindle repair services focus on restoring the vertical support posts that run along the perimeter of a deck. These spindles not only add to the aesthetic appeal but also provide essential safety and stability. Repair projects typically involve replacing broken, rotted, or loose spindles, as well as addressing issues with the mounting points or handrails connected to them. Homeowners often seek this service when spindles become damaged due to weather exposure, age, or accidents, ensuring their deck remains safe and visually appealing.
Before requesting deck spindle rep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of damage and whether replacement or repair is more appropriate. It’s helpful to assess if the spindles are loose, cracked, or rotted, and to determine if the existing hardware needs updating. Additionally, understanding the materials used-such as wood, vinyl, or composite-can influence repair options and costs. Clear communication about the style and finish of the spindles can also help ensure the repair blends seamlessly with the existing deck design.

Deck Spindle Repair Questions
What are deck spindles? Deck spindles are the vertical posts that support the handrail and enclosure of a deck, providing safety and style.
Why might spindles need repair? Spindles can become loose, cracked, or damaged over time due to weather or wear, affecting deck stability.
What signs indicate spindle damage? Visible cracks, wobbling, or missing spindles are common signs that repair or replacement is needed.
Are repairs suitable for all types of spindles? Repairs are typically possible for wood, vinyl, or composite spindles, depending on the extent of damage.
